Turns out it was, in fact, the protocol.

OpenVPN shoots itself on the foot by reducing my 1Gbps connection (920Mbps-240Mbps true speed) to something between 120Mbps and 150Mbps.

Wireguard on the other hand never drops bellow 880Mbps.

With Mullvad droping OpenVPN support by the beginning of 2026, there is no contest.

Beware of the tax OP. My mother brought the family car in the NL and when it was time to register it the RDW asked for 21% of the catalog value of the car. For a car that was made on 2004 21% of its original value was just way too much. Run the numbers first to make sure its worth it.
